Output ef12d985c6bdadc7b8fe8f083f50c6c5955edf2ce1dd1dee7e0234f7b2443cd3:17

value
2166407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c9049aa1a1ceb22d12d13f9c4cad66bb9b7f4c OP_EQUAL
address
39L2pSUk8EJa1u3WHwxBJGZhtsDESx2Z25
transaction
ef12d985c6bdadc7b8fe8f083f50c6c5955edf2ce1dd1dee7e0234f7b2443cd3
spent
true